Transaction 5d59467adc7bc9862c0cafa12214bfb317555366f0ba88f9b0e53a162855ab30

2 Input
2 Outputs
  • 5d59467adc7bc9862c0cafa12214bfb317555366f0ba88f9b0e53a162855ab30:0
  • value  3370654
    address  1CPL759V2DFDp9Jp1HPuhGGCjkGecNa9sc
  • 5d59467adc7bc9862c0cafa12214bfb317555366f0ba88f9b0e53a162855ab30:1
  • value  70573200
    address  1KqNLWnw6j9Mr11XrnQBJTzT28yDjsidzZ